FAQ's of Rabbit CTGF(Connective Tissue Growth Factor) ELISA Kit:
Q: How does the Rabbit CTGF ELISA Kit perform quantitative detection?
A: The kit utilizes a Sandwich ELISA principle, capturing CTGF from samples such as serum, plasma, and tissue homogenate onto pre-coated microplates. Detection is achieved with a series of reagent steps involving standards, detection antibodies, HRP conjugate, and substrate, providing precise quantitative analysis.

Q: What equipment is required for running the Rabbit CTGF ELISA Kit?
A: You'll need a 450 nm microplate reader, pipettes, and an incubator. The kit supplies all necessary reagents, including pre-coated microplates, standard, detection antibody, and substrates.
Q: Where can I store the kit and for how long does it remain stable?
A: Store the complete ELISA kit refrigerated at 2-8C, and don't freeze components unless specified. When stored properly, the shelf life ranges from 6 to 12 weeks.
